Créer compte SQL
lPreduSl
Messages postés
56
Date d'inscription
Statut
Membre
Dernière intervention
-
heliconius Messages postés 539 Date d'inscription Statut Membre Dernière intervention -
heliconius Messages postés 539 Date d'inscription Statut Membre Dernière intervention -
Bonsoir,
Comment puis-je créer un compte sur mysqld (linus, CentOS) pour réussir à limiter l'accès à une seule personne ?
Des anciens camarades ont su faire quelque chose qui permettait de créer un utilisateur, un mot de passe, et de fixer ce compte à une adresse IP. Donc seulement cette IP pouvait, avec les bons logs, se connecter. Sinon, quand bien même les logs seraient bons, il serait impossible de s'y connecter.
J'aimerai savoir comment faire pour limiter l'accès à un compte SQL à une seule adresse IP. Ou un système similaire
Merci !
Comment puis-je créer un compte sur mysqld (linus, CentOS) pour réussir à limiter l'accès à une seule personne ?
Des anciens camarades ont su faire quelque chose qui permettait de créer un utilisateur, un mot de passe, et de fixer ce compte à une adresse IP. Donc seulement cette IP pouvait, avec les bons logs, se connecter. Sinon, quand bien même les logs seraient bons, il serait impossible de s'y connecter.
J'aimerai savoir comment faire pour limiter l'accès à un compte SQL à une seule adresse IP. Ou un système similaire
Merci !
A voir également:
- Créer compte SQL
- Créer un compte google - Guide
- Créer un compte gmail - Guide
- Créer un compte instagram sur google - Guide
- Comment créer un groupe whatsapp - Guide
- Créer un compte twitter - Guide
1 réponse
yg_be
Messages postés
23541
Date d'inscription
Statut
Contributeur
Dernière intervention
Ambassadeur
1 584
bonjour, comment les utilisateurs ont-ils accès, à distance, à ta base de données? avec quel programme?
connais-tu les commandes "CREATE USER" et "GRANT"?
connais-tu les commandes "CREATE USER" et "GRANT"?
j'entre cela :
Les gens s'y connectent avec Navicat.
Autoriser l'accès à distance sur votre serveur MySQL
dans laquelle :
- 'user' : cela signifie à partir de n'importe où
- 'user'@'%' : cela signifie à partir de n'importe où, comme précédemment
- 'user'@'192.168.0.15' : seulement si user se connecte à partir de la machine IP n° tant et pas ailleurs
- 'user'@'host.domain.tld' : idem que ci-dessus mais avec FQDN
- 'user'@'localhost' : seulement par ses scripts locaux ou la console locale
Si un utilisateur donné doit pouvoir y accéder à partir de deux machines différentes, taper deux fois la commande avec des désignations de lieux de connexion différents (dans ce cas, le nom d'utilisateur peut être le même avec, soit le même mot de passe soit des mots de passe différents : 1 à partir d'une machine et 1 autre à partir d'une autre machine)